Technical Training Manager
Manages the localized technical training program and its corresponding Area Training Center (ATC) to strengthen retailer technician capability, improve warranty efficiency, and drive customer loyalty. Develops technicians at all tenure, experience, and skill levels through structured training delivery, skill validation, and ongoing development aligned to Subaru and industry standards. Partners with internal and external stakeholders to support retailer technician education; increase Subaru-University (Subaru-U) engagement;
strengthen field quality assurance efforts; and oversee facility, inventory, and asset management.
- Delivers high-quality technical training facilitation for retailer technicians, internal field staff, and other relevant technical roles utilizing a broad curriculum portfolio while adapting to a wide range of tenure, experience, and skill levels.
- Provides comprehensive assessment of students throughout course delivery and completes corresponding evaluations of those students.
- Educates and promotes Subaru Technical Training programs and initiatives such as STATURE, Pinnacle, and enriching education opportunities, such as web-based engagements and online-resources, to local retailers, Subaru field, and others in the community.
- Plans and manages Area Training Center (ATC) operational and administrative needs to enable retailer success in metrics such as calendars, Subaru Technical Training Requirements (STTR), and Dispatch scores.
- Implements and enforces ATC policies and practices to ensure consistent retailer experience and SOA compliance.
- Identifies, prioritizes, collaborates, and resolves ATC opportunities, issues, and feedback related to technical training development and delivery, Subaru-University (Subaru-U), and field and retailer needs.
- Maintains expert-level technical knowledge and skills while staying current on trends, vehicle technologies, repair methods, and diagnostic practices.
- Maintains ATC facilities and capital assets (such as vehicles, tools, equipment, supplies, etc.) to meet Subaru of America (SOA) facility standards, safety/security protocols, and budget controls.
- Leads ATC/Zone special projects from scope through completion to support unique field and retailer needs such as Service Manager Meetings, Fast-Track programs, and Automotive Service Excellence (ASE) testing.
- Builds and promotes relationships with industry and community organizations to strengthen Subaru presence and awareness.
- Represents SOA in the automotive community through active participation on school advisory boards, trade groups, and relevant associations.
- Champions Subaru brand, product, operation, and technology to automotive schools by training vocational instructors annually through local/regional/national vocational seminars.
- Attends and supports national technical training initiatives and conferences such as Train-the-Trainer (T3) events, National Training Conference (NTC), and Aftersales Business Conference (ABC).
- Bachelor's Degree required Or H.S. Diploma and equivalent automotive-related work experience in lieu of degree required
- At least 6-8 years required
- Collaborative, team-oriented work style.
- Strong verbal and written communication skills with internal and external stakeholders.
- Skilled in providing constructive feedback and clear direction.
- Ability to perform vehicle repairs in a shop environment while following established Subaru of America (SOA) and industry standard safety guidelines.
- Strong background in hands-on automotive repair and diagnosis.
- Strong conflict resolution and creative thinking skills.
- Strong organization, planning, and time management skills
- Ability to multi-task effectively across physical and digital work.
- ASE Automobile & Light Truck Certifications (A1 - A8) - Master Automobile Technician
- ASE Advanced Engine Performance Specialist Certification (L1), Required And ASE Light Duty Hybrid/Electric Vehicle Specialist Certification (L3)
- ASE Advanced Driver Assistance Systems (ADAS) Specialist Certification (L4)
